java代码中查询功能如何实现
时间: 2024-01-17 12:04:51 浏览: 145
在Java代码中实现查询功能,通常需要以下步骤:
1. 定义查询条件:根据业务需求,确定需要查询的字段和条件,例如查询某个时间段内的订单信息。
2. 构建SQL语句:根据查询条件,构建SQL语句,例如使用SELECT、WHERE、AND等关键字拼接SQL语句。
3. 执行查询:使用JDBC或ORM框架等技术,执行SQL查询语句,并获取查询结果。
4. 处理查询结果:对查询结果进行处理,例如将结果封装成Java对象、JSON格式等。
5. 返回查询结果:将处理后的查询结果返回给调用方。
以下是一个简单的示例代码,演示如何在Java中实现查询功能:
```java
// 定义查询条件
String startDate = "2021-01-01";
String endDate = "2021-01-31";
// 构建SQL语句
String sql = "SELECT * FROM order WHERE order_date BETWEEN ? AND ?";
// 执行查询
Connection conn = DriverManager.getConnection(url, username, password);
PreparedStatement stmt = conn.prepareStatement(sql);
stmt.setString(1, startDate);
stmt.setString(2, endDate);
ResultSet rs = stmt.executeQuery();
// 处理查询结果
List<Order> orders = new ArrayList<>();
while (rs.next()) {
Order order = new Order();
order.setId(rs.getInt("id"));
order.setOrderDate(rs.getDate("order_date"));
order.setAmount(rs.getDouble("amount"));
orders.add(order);
}
// 返回查询结果
return orders;
```
阅读全文